    Story in the Post today that Betfair’s SP system crashed on the National, returning 3/1 on the winner because there were no layers!
    They’ve had to pay out at 9.5-1 to backers and settle lay bets at 3/1, costing them a nice few quid.
    This is the inherent weakness of their SP system- you can’t guarantee there will be enough people laying to balance the SP backers or vice versa.

    It presents BF with a big problem. The calculation basically depends on there being enough SP layer liabiltiy to stand SP backers. When this doesn’t happen they have to go into the unmatched exchange market and match bets there to pay the SP backers. On Saturday they had to go deep into the exchange to pay the backers and the SP tumbled. The system failed its first major test badly.

    As it stands there in nothing to stop it happening again on Derby Day. Also the big bookmakers could easily place big SP bets on the exchange and force the SP to collapse on every race if they wanted, leaving BF with no option but to manipulate the SP for marketing purposes and standing the losses themselves as happened on Saturday.

    It will be very interesting to see how they handle this and what solutions will be forthcoming because a massive loophole was exposed on Saturday.
